Queensland ILCA State Championships 13 – 14 July 24
Competitors from all over QLD and some from interstate made up the 44 boat fleet across 3 divisions.
A day of spray on the Bay, The 13-15kts WSW winds and the short chop synonymous with Waterloo Bay, made it quite spectacular to watch, and difficult to see where they were going.
Mark rounding’s were a thrill to watch as the laser fleets planed their way into the downwind legs at speed.
The cold South Westerlies greeted the competitors for the final day of the regatta. Good conditions in the bay for the competitors on the Southern course with the final 3 racesclosely fought. The top mark proved to be the deciding point where the rules ruled and positions were gained, or lost.
Queensland ILCA Association State Championships Awards Presentation was very casual and relaxed event on the Sailing office lawn. Competitors and supporters jostled for position in the sun, especially after a big day on the bay.
ILCA 4 – (11 Competitors)
Henry Piggott – 1st
James Dale – 2nd
Jeremy Liu – 3rd
ILCA 6 Men – (16 Competitors)
Simon Small – 1st
Jackson Black – 2nd
William Cullen – 3rd
ILCA 6 Women – (8 Competitors)
Sylvie Stannage – 1st
Lyndall Patterson – 2nd
Gina Johnstone – 3rd
ILCA 7 – (9 Competitors)
Michael Wilson – 1st
Gerry Donohoe – 2nd
Andrew Verrall – 3rd
